About RankWeek Expand
RankWeek provides a specialized product for website owners and SEO specialists facing Google indexing issues. It integrates with Google Search Console to automatically identify pages that are not indexed and then re-submits them for indexing.
This automation helps to resolve common SEO problems, ensuring that valuable content is visible in search results and improving overall search rankings. By focusing on this specific pain point, RankWeek offers a direct alternative to time-consuming manual processes, making it easier to maintain a healthy online presence.
